Automotive Technician
About the role
Join our team and receive a $2,500 sign-on bonus for experienced Maintenance Technicians. This is our way of rewarding skilled technicians who are ready to grow with our team.
Responsibilities
- Inspect, diagnose, and repair automotive systems including brakes, suspension, alignment, engine performance, air conditioning, and coolant systems
- Troubleshoot problems and demonstrate strong diagnostic skills using the latest technology
- Mentor teammates and continually learn new techniques as automotive technology evolves
- Maintain high standards of safety, service, and housekeeping while using protective equipment
- Perform manual tasks such as lifting tires/wheels and standing, bending, and squatting for extended periods
Requirements
- Minimum of three years' automotive repair experience—OR three years as a military vehicle maintenance specialist—demonstrating advanced diagnostic and problem-solving skills, including identifying, troubleshooting, and resolving complex mechanical and electrical faults.
- Valid driver's license and ability to work a flexible schedule, including some evenings, weekends, and holidays
- Preferred: ASE A4 (Steering & Suspension) and A5 (Brakes) Certifications, state inspection license, or MAC certification

Net Zero by 2050
Goodyear is focused on creating value for all its stakeholders, which comes through in the company's commitment to sustainability. Goodyear is committed to ethical and sustainable practices designed to protect its people and the planet, and company is dedicated to providing a safe and healthy workplace. The company's corporate responsibility framework, Goodyear Better Future, guides its work and helps ensure that sustainability is integrated at all levels of the company and guides its sustainability strategy. Goodyear's sustainability goals include operating its global manufacturing facilities at 100% renewable electricity by 2030 and 100% renewable energy by 2040 and reaching net-zero greenhouse gas emissions across its value chain by 2050.
